High Performance MySQL: Optimierung, Datensicherung & Lastverteilung

Posted by Hume under Database

Product Description
As users come to depend on MySQL, they find that they have to deal with issues of reliability, scalability, and performance–issues that are not well documented but are critical to a smoothly functioning site. This book is an insider’s guide to these little understood topics. Author Jeremy Zawodny has managed large numbers of MySQL servers for mission-critical work at Yahoo!, maintained years of contacts with the MySQL AB team, and presents regularly at conferences. Jeremy and Derek have spent months experimenting, interviewing major users of MySQL, talking to MySQL AB, benchmarking, and writing some of their own tools in order to produce the information in this book.

Introduction to Database Systems, An (8th Edition)

Posted by Hume under Database

Introduction to Database Systems, An (8th Edition)
Publisher: Addison Wesley | ISBN: 0321189566 | edition 2003 | DJVU | 1024 pages | 26,8 mb

“ The newest edition of the classic An Introduction to Database Systems incorporates the latest developments in relational databases, including semantic modeling, decision support, and temporal modeling. There’s better information on distributed databases, security, and the mathematics of relational databases too. With the same strong coverage of fundamental theory that made its predecessors stand out, this book ranks as the definitive textbook for those studying database systems.
